Dalkia deploys Gentrack Billing and CRM software solution in Ireland

30 April 2010: Dalkia, Europe’s leading company in Energy Management, Utilities and Facilities solutions, has successfully deployed the Gentrack Velocity utility billing and CRM software.

Gentrack, a leading supplier of smart software solutions to energy and water utilities, today announced the successful completion of a project to deliver its specialist utility billing, CRM and collections application to Dalkia in Ireland. Dalkia is the energy division of Veolia Environment, a global leader in environmental solutions employing over 300,000 people worldwide.

The 12-week project included the implementation of Gentrack’s smart billing and CRM software to enable Dalkia to bill its customers in residential and commercial district heating schemes across Ireland, while also effectively supporting communications and revenue collections activities of Dalkia’s heating service provision to these same customers.

Gentrack CEO James Docking said the project was a huge success given the complexities of heating schemes in Ireland, in particular calculating and apportioning heat losses.

“Gentrack Velocity has a robust utility billing engine used in a number of utilities worldwide. This engine is the key to enabling companies like Dalkia to handle a multitude of price and tariff variables for accurately calculating heat usage and losses,” he said. “Dalkia set us the challenge of delivering to a tight timeframe and I am pleased to say they are now live on the new Gentrack Velocity system after an intense testing regime completed earlier this year.”

In addition to supporting Dalkia’s heating billing requirements, the newly implemented Gentrack Velocity system provides a set of smart CRM and collections tools to enable Dalkia to deliver improved levels of customer service and to offer customers a range of flexible payment options.
